Interior Designer: Practical Career Info
Could interior design be the career for you? In this article we’ll focus on the creativity aspect of this profession.
Creativity is a subtle, but essential quality to have when considering interior design as a career. Much of your advancement will depend on your ability to be original in your creative efforts to design any space. Clients will always want to work with a designer that can offer them something that nobody else has.
Often clients might not want to change everything, or buy new furnishings and draperies; they simply want to make whatever they do have look and feel different. Creative thinking is the only thing that is going to help here.
Colors are your ally, and creativity can help you in setting colors against one another. Many designers love to add color to a room and change things just using this method and perhaps adding accents to existing items.
Accents in a room can vary. You can create a great space by adding throw pillows, valances, and vases.
Interior design could be the perfect career choice for a person that likes to be creative, but not idle and/or isolated.
